    The game of Bottezk Zvaerdz

    Bottezk Zvaerdz is a game originating from the lands of Hanseti-Ruska. Using wooden tops created intentionally for this entertaining battle game, competitors release their tops in the wooden Bottezk Zvaerd arena to test who the strongest player in the realm is! This game can be played by 2+ players, although standard-sized stadiums will become rather crowded at around 8 competitors.

     


    Rules of the Game

    • I. To begin the round, the competitors must count down from three and declare “Zvas supae vy!” (or “Let it rip!” in common) and release their tops into the arena at the same time.
    • II. The tops in the wooden arena will battle until one is knocked out of the arena, or falls. If both fall at the same time, the round will be called a tie.
    • III. The last to remain spinning in the arena will be named the victor of the round. If the victor’s opponent fell, the victor receives +1 point. If the victor’s opponent was knocked out of the arena, the victor received +2 points.
    • IV. The first to reach 10 points wins the game.
    • V. If playing with more than two players, add 5 points to the end goal for each extra person.
    • VI. Even when playing with more than two players, only one top may remain standing at the end for points to be awarded.
    • VII. When playing with more than two players, you may earn points for every top that was knocked out or knocked down.

     


    [OOC Rules]

    • I. [Each player rolls out of 20 when the round starts.
    • II. The player with the highest roll wins the round.
    • III. A player who is beaten by more than 10 in a roll is knocked out of the arena. If the difference is less than 10, they are only knocked down. This applies regardless of the number of players.]

  7. Traditional Haeseni Dress and Attire

    6th of Jula and Piov, 328 | 6th of Malin’s Welcome, 1775

    UnCZCPlKRH_d-RDeUiCO8dVKN-_wKfOnti81CiRyT5xlqzCl94lP_IdCSmYNVP-CTQrcH1Zl5YFQulrpT61-xgKOAz5OdCEZb5ci60-Ytj5x_iqevAFJ67pU5Yp-bztOeU4Eb7mZ

     


    Coats and Furs

    Khanbej

    (Khan = Coat, Bej = Long)

    The khanbej is a traditional, high-quality coat, commonly worn by Haensemen of high standing. The coats are generally rather long, sometimes decorated with detailed embroidery or patterning. The khanbej is a favored clothing item of Ruskan descent, hailing back hundreds of years. Although worn out of necessity in the cold northern climate, the garment also displays power, masculinity, and wealth.

     

    3FI6l5t0-xg0GcB9T0IRQOtxk3WqVexGbscjARt4zmI5mxIu-bkBbYTB3obFutd9DLVPVYK2xErpSsN64cKmEzxylMyCPqMG-Qv7kKr96hRCggadkg0GMX6f1fCbtataGbyt-FRc

     

    Darskholv

    (Darusz = Furry, Kholv = Cold)

    The darskholv is a common clothing piece worn by both men and women throughout the kingdom. Both fur stoles and fur coats are included in the generalized term, ‘darskholv.’ These garments are worn to stave off the biting cold during frigid Haeseni winters. Generally tailored of rabbit, fox, or mink fur, they offer not only protection from the cold, but unique fashion within the Haeseni courts. Men and women of high status and skill may wear darskholvz of wolf pelt to display honor and bravery. The darskholv, just like the khanbej, was also a historically Ruskan vestment.


    Dresses and Gowns

    Sanguss

    (Sansk = Dress, Guss = Poor)

    The sanguss is a traditional dress worn by Haeseni women of low status. These dresses, generally sewn with inexpensive or cheap fabrics, are beautiful nonetheless. The dresses feature distinct cinching strings across the bodice, and ribbon bows around the waist. The positioning of the ribbon, if worn properly, is important to note. A woman with a bow-tied against her right hip is displaying her married status, a woman with a bow tied across her middle may be undecided or courting, and a woman with a bow on her left hip remains unspoken for. This garment is traditional of Hansetian dress, passed down through generations of Haeseni women.

     

    dOgHE1U6quNzTM_FwxbYfRA0wkVmqALcdvqo9fvzdc4JH9etbtedMrCJReIj-RqqhWagVKRN44x4WSIjU0UwgN_rVvwugIxE_nwkBdsnvkJ_eu4Tmpmgu11w0gyGvA57t__BKT2k

     

    Sanbej

    (Sansk = Dress, Bej = Long)

    The sanbej is the expensive counterpart to the sanguss. These fine gowns, worn by women of high standing and wealth, are common among the royalty and nobility within Hanseti-Ruska. They are finely tailored with materials such as silk, satin, and linen. These dresses do not generally feature the classic bow of the sanguss, and instead, don classier patterns and embroidering. These gowns are most often worn at floor-length, and consist of multiple layers of fabric, helping to insulate against the chill.


    Hats, Shoes, and Otherwise

    Heusjet

    (Heut = Hat)

    The heusjet, known in common as the beret, is the most commonly worn hat in the Kingdom of Hanseti-Ruska. These are usually worn by men, but women may also be seen donning these hats. The heusjet is a more recent addition to tradition Haeseni garb, becoming more common within the last century, and has recently been added to the uniforms of the Haense Royal Army.

     

    Baijlejz

    (Baijlej = Boot)

    Baijlejz are the most commonly worn footwear, having been crafted and sold for hundreds of years. These boots are made of sturdy leather and can range from ankle-high to more than halfway up the shin. The soles of these boots are generally made from maple or elmwood and are well polished and sealed. A wide range of options can be seen in these shoes, and are worn by both men and women. 

     

    t_MVi9aAWmyeu7BhV4dUEZupuu3WKSu0IOUDa8hXuICZ4TIMWYdlZ57Q7voMgu8C-WMH91CPebOYyf-9nMdhGtJsahEuujN4LqPi1jSGb6Er4hSfo_V7JrbNoRm5DkXvLsQSjG9u

     

    Anzkhanz

    (Anz = Hands, Khan = Coat)

    Anzkhan is simply the New Marian word for ‘glove.’ Usually made out of leather or wool, anzkhanz are worn throughout the winter months to protect the hands from the icy cold. These small accessories are generally fairly simple in appearance, worn more so for practicality than a sense of fashion.


    Plate and Uniforms

    Platen

    (Platen = Plate Armor)

    Platen is mostly worn by the nobility of the Kingdom, the majority of which represents the colors of each House. Consisting of more expensive material, platen is not seen as often, unless worn by a soldier of higher ranking, or the aforementioned nobility. Due to the colder climate of Hanseti-Ruska the armor is typically insulated and worn with varying amounts of fur.

     

    Junen

    (Junen = Uniform)

    Junen is adorned most often by the Royal Army of the Kingdom, though can be seen within the levies of the past and present. The current junen of the Kingdom represents the coat of arms of the King, displaying a red and white background with the colors of House Barbanov forming the shape of a shield.

  14. The Royal Academy of Saint Catherine

    9th of Vzmey and Hyff, 321 E.S.|9th of The First Seed, 1768

    JA66ieN61qzKJ-_0l9G4yTmLYjAMifrx6c45s4wof9iJuGYqXPugUQLdfgWYxqLc0taH2vdB6k5BfOqJdh6MKrDIwyLKnDl9o3rLtYMhytstG30OK7yQSXroo4XGdS75G8F9sju0

     


     

    The Royal Academy of Saint Catherine was originally put in place by Her Late Majesty Maya of Muldav; however, due to her untimely death, the state of The Academy fell into a state of disuse for a period. Armande de Falstaff had attempted to take charge of it and reform classes, though remained occupied by other matters. So, Her Royal Majesty Viktoria and two of the Royal Triplets, Princess Alexandria and Princess Amelya, have decided to come together and breathe life back into The Academy and offer education to the denizens of Hanseti-Ruska; as Her Late Majesty had once attempted years ago. The Academy will be run and managed by the Princesses Alexandria and Amelya Barbanov.

     


    Culture Concentrations

     

    Holidays, Festivals, and Events:

    A course focused on notable events and traditional celebrations within Haeseni culture. 

     

    New Marian Language:

    This class focuses on studying the official language of Hanseti-Ruska. Take this course to learn vocabulary, grammar, and formal language.

     

    Biharism and Important Texts:

    This course focuses on Haeseni politics and their roots, as well as important documents written by scholarly Haensemen of the past.

     

    Cultures of Humanity:

    This course’s purpose is to enlighten the minds of the youth and to educate them more about the civilizations outside of Haense; for it is important to possess a broadened mindset on the land.

     

    Orenian Law:

    The study of Orenian Law consists of learning how to use and apply the Oren Revised Code.

     


    History Concentrations

     

    Monarchs and Notable Figures of Haense:

    This class covers past royalty, government officials, military leaders, saints, and idols that were cherished by old generations. Study famous Haensemen such as Robert Sigismund and Stefan I.

     

    Haeseni Mythology and Folklore:

    A course that focuses on old Haeseni folk tales, myths, and legends of old. If you’re one for the curious and fanciful, this class is for you.

     

    The Petrovic Era: 1577-1612

    This is a general class covering the history of the Petrovic Era. This is the first of a set of three classes, which will rotate every three semesters. This means that only one of the three ‘Historic Era’ classes will be taught per semester. 

     

    The Ottonian Era: 1612-1666

    This is a general class covering the history of the Ottonian Era. This is the second of a set of three classes, which will rotate every three semesters. This means that only one of the three ‘Historic Era’ classes will be taught per semester. 

     

    The Early Bihar Era: 1666-1719

    This is a general class covering the history of the Bihar Era. This is the third of a set of three classes, which will rotate every three semesters. This means that only one of the three ‘Historic Era’ classes will be taught per semester.

     

    Contemporary Human History:

    This class focuses on important events and occurrences within the Holy Orenian Empire and the human realm as a whole over the past several decades.

     


    Finer Skills Concentrations

     

    Music:

    A course focusing on the use of different instruments, generally selected by the student, alongside reading, and composing musical pieces.

     

    Painting:

    This class helps to teach young artists how to create masterpieces with a set of paints and a bit of guidance. Students will be taught methods, strategies, and ways to practice with their talent.

     

    Swordsmanship:

    This course is key for any young soldier or future knight. Learn the safest and most efficient ways to wield a blade under a skilled tutor.

     

    Theology:

    This course is to focus on the study of the nature of GOD and Canonist teachings and beliefs.

     

    Medicine:

    Courses for this subject focus on the teaching of medicinal treatments in regards to the ill and injured.

     

    Botany:

    Classes in this course are to educate the youth on the various types and uses of plants found within and outside of the Kingdom of Haense.

     

    Standard Etiquette:

    Focusing on the etiquette of the Royal Court of Hanseti-Ruska, this course will teach titles and greetings of nobles, and many other mannerisms suited for the nobility of Haense.

     

    Military Etiquette:

    A course on the addressment of superiors within the military, and how soldiers of the Kingdom should hold themselves.

     

    Cadet Leadership Course:

    This course is closely linked to the Haense Royal Army and will be taught by other military officers. The goal of this class is to lay a base for young Haeseni fighters to achieve future military greatness.

     

    efmwvNYocG7ZRBO7o0m3RvLrKiwvhu5qL-Ncqhss4_z3zFr4s1uoHQ8-qxG0zgYEIdMEiJDF-DEbH8sh1b4VL8Bkw5dYnqfy0aqVixG2zR4ZprORypOaoSdUsWlsEbH_A02f-OQM

     


    Structure of the Academy

     

    Semesters and Classes:

    1.  Semesters will last 3 Saints’ weeks each.
    2. Three semesters will form one full academic rotation. 
      1.  The ‘Historic Era’ classes, in particular, will follow this schedule. Only one of the three classes, the Petrovic Era, the Ottonian Era, and the Early Bihar Era, will be held each semester to minimize the history tutors’ workload.
    3.  Classes require at least 2 students in order for the class to be taught that semester and cap out at 8 students. First come, first served.

     

    Completing Terms and Graduating:

    1.  The base class requirements to be eligible for graduation and a diploma are three semesters of a full class load of 3 classes a semester or 9 classes in total. A student may alternatively take on a lighter class load, but attend more semesters to meet the requirement of 9 classes completed.
    2. In order to graduate, the student must publish a thesis to prove their intellect, not necessarily on the whole of their class, but on the subject of such.
      1.  The student may then present their thesis publicly within the Weeping Wick Theatre as a speech.
    3. Every graduate of the Academy will receive an official diploma, custom to each graduate’s courses and skills.

     

    Tutor Requirements:

    1.  In order to apply as a tutor for the Academy, write a letter to either of the Headmistresses covering what classes you would be interested in teaching, and what knowledge you have of the subjects.
    2. Tutors must be above the age of majority in the Holy Orenian Empire, 16, in order to instruct students. 
    3. They must have a vast and full understanding of their subjects.
    4. Tutors must hold each of their designated classes at least once per Saints’ week throughout the entire semester.

     

    Student Enrollment:

    1.   In order to enroll in the Royal Academy as a student, write a letter to either Princess Amelya Valeriya or Princess Alexandria Karina.
      1. This letter must include the classes the student wants to enroll in for the upcoming semester. They may choose between 1 and 3 classes per semester.
      2. The letter must be sent prior to the start of the semester. Few exceptions will be made to this rule.
      3. The Headmistresses will later reply with either a request to meet in person or the information regarding tutors, classes, etc.
    2. Students must be five or older to enroll in the Academy. 

             a. This means that adults are also eligible to take classes.

    The Speech of the Highlands

    A strong, well-known feature of strong northern men is the distinct gruffness and drawl to their tone. Though these accents have faded over the centuries of our kingdom’s great existence, remnants of the past remain within some of our nobility. The northern men of House Baruch, in particular, retain the strongest northern and Marian-like accent in our time. This accent includes deepness of tone, the omission of hard ‘H’ sounds as well as ‘T’s.

     

    Though the return of such accents to our people as a whole is unlikely, it’s important to recollect upon the changes in our kingdom. Our strong, Raev roots are the building blocks for the individuality and great history of Hanseti-Ruska, and we must acknowledge such.  

    *

     


    *

    Traditional Dress

    Haeseni dress has always differed largely from that of our Crownlander counterparts. This is mainly due to the major change in climates between our cities; our own homeland being far colder than that of the Orenians. It has always been custom for highlanders to wear furs and cloaks for insulation purposes, but we seem to have forgotten other elements and trends from the past.

     

    Colorful garb has always been a beautiful element of Haeseni style, and one that we seem to have left behind in recent years. Old paintings depict colorful and spectacular articles of clothing, rather than the shabby, colorless overcoats that have flooded our dirt streets. Though black clothing is generally preferred in today’s society, the lack of color and individuality among our gowns and tailcoats has reached its peak. It’s time to throw out the musty potato sacks and make room for wonderful colors.

     

    Not only have we grown distant from colorful clothing, but also accessories worn in the past. Berets were worn frequently, The Blue Berets during the War of Two Emperors were a notable group who wore such hats. Thanks to the work of our king, in recent years berets have made a strong return in the uniforms of the Haense Royal Army (HRA). 

     

    Idj9bOsaJZPlXLydtxAIiMkx6f9fu6hXLiY5767ztKzWn7bcIccmWRKFFnrSgMKpFzXw18hGQGcHTWkKgNUvxUfnTtnmtANTqhB2T7VJyyXC9JJ_pY7No6w1JTnzCYQUGEEl200s

    [!] The late Otto Sigmar circa 1760 revisiting the beret fashion style of his youth.

    ((Art by Unbaed))

     

    *


    *

    Haeseni Cuisine

    Though Carrion Black has been a key staple of our drinking habits for decades, we seem to have forgotten the old Haeseni treat of rum-spiked cocoa. An important recipe to the women of House Barbanov for generations, hot cocoa quickly made its way to the bars of common-folk and nobility alike. As with any beverage, the northern men of Haense spiked the favorable drink. Rum, the sweet alcohol created from distilling molasses, was a natural option.

     

    This warm, soothing drink became a beloved drink of soldiers weathering the cold in war camps, a warming beverage to enjoy while spending late nights drinking in the tavern, and a welcome gift to a home-coming husband or son upon returning from duty. A vague recipe is as listed below. 

     

    Haeseni Spiked Cocoa ‘Recipe’

    - Hot milk

    - Cocoa powder

    - Sugar

    - Rum

     

    bjxhWT9OouGw2ozJ20qXGtu6g5CtQieDjBurkrTxyobu_5uqNDi6ZiEww--Pm72npM2is73hHVoVxnTqQnOUQYR840SYIG533Suh8Y4-aaLPiFp77G4SwSscyx2PRBbaZ8_Q-9eV
    [!] A painting of the Markev tavern on one particularly active evening.

     

    Recently, four traditional berries have made their way back into Haeseni cuisine. These fruits, generally known as Prikaz berries, are found upon rocks and can be used to create a variety of beverages and foods. Wild Prikaz is commonly used to make Prikaz Tea. Red Prikaz is used to make Prikaz Wine, a staple beverage within the kingdom, and to make jams. Hansetian Prikaz can be used in cooking, or sun-dried and eaten alone. Royal Prikaz is fermented to create Edeylvise, a traditional red wine. These berries are delectable and have many general uses for the Haeseni people.
